Oasis begins rehearsals for their long-awaited musical reunion
After years of speculation and rumors, brothers Liam and Noel Gallagher have taken the first official step towards the return of their iconic band, Oasis. According to reports from the Daily Mail, formal rehearsals will begin this week at an undisclosed location in the United Kingdom, marking a milestone in the history of British rock.
A historic reunion
Last Monday, Liam Gallagher met with his bandmates, although without the initial presence of his brother Noel. However, sources close to the band confirmed that both will share space this week for the first time since their separation in 2009. This moment not only symbolizes the brothers’ reconciliation, but also the prelude to a world tour that will begin in Cardiff, United Kingdom.
The vocalist, known for his frank character, did not hide his enthusiasm on social networks. On his X (formerly Twitter) account, Liam wryly commented: “Oasis rehearsals get more coverage than most idiot bands’ tours.” In addition, he warned his followers that there will be no photos or public meetings during the rehearsals: “They will not see me, I am not an imposter, I will enter and leave.”
Preparations and expectations
Although rehearsals began last month, Liam’s addition marks a turning point. The band is already fine-tuning details for its return to the stage, which has generated expectations among fans of alternative rock and music in general. The tour promises to revive hits like “Wonderwall” and “Don’t Look Back in Anger”, songs that defined a generation.
This reunion is not only relevant for Oasis fans, but also for the music industry, which has seen few reconciliations of this magnitude. The last time the Gallagher brothers shared the stage was 15 years ago, and their dynamic has always been a topic of public debate.
While details of the tour remain under wraps, rehearsals confirm that the project is moving forward. The band could announce additional dates in Europe, America and Asia in the coming months.
